When it comes to understanding how a computer works, one of the most important components to learn about is the motherboard The motherboard is essentially the backbone of the computer, connecting all the various components together to allow them to communicate and work harmoniously In this article, we will delve into the key components of a motherboard and their functions.
1 CPU Socket: The Central Processing Unit (CPU) socket is a crucial component of the motherboard where the processor is installed The CPU is often referred to as the brain of the computer, as it is responsible for executing instructions and performing calculations Different motherboards support different CPU sockets, so it’s important to ensure compatibility when choosing a motherboard for your build.
2 Chipset: The chipset is a set of integrated circuits on the motherboard that manages communication between the CPU, memory, storage devices, and other peripherals It also controls the flow of data between these components and determines which features are supported by the motherboard The chipset plays a vital role in the overall performance and capabilities of the system.
3 RAM Slots: Random Access Memory (RAM) is used by the computer to temporarily store data that is being actively used by the system The RAM slots on the motherboard allow for the installation of RAM modules, which can vary in speed, capacity, and type Adding more RAM to a system can improve performance by allowing for more data to be quickly accessed by the CPU.
4 Expansion Slots: Expansion slots on the motherboard allow for additional components, such as graphics cards, sound cards, and network adapters, to be added to the system These slots come in various types, such as PCI, PCI Express, and M.2, each with different capabilities in terms of bandwidth and speed Expansion slots provide flexibility for upgrading or customizing a computer system.

SATA connectors are commonly used for traditional hard drives, while M.2 connectors are more commonly used for faster solid-state drives These connectors allow for data to be stored and accessed by the system.
6 Power Connectors: Power connectors on the motherboard provide the necessary power to the various components of the system The main power connector connects to the power supply unit, while additional connectors provide power to the CPU, graphics card, and other components Proper power delivery is essential for the stability and performance of the system.
7 BIOS Chip: The Basic Input/Output System (BIOS) chip is a small piece of firmware that is stored on the motherboard and is responsible for initializing the hardware components of the system during the boot process The BIOS chip also contains the settings and configurations for the motherboard, which can be accessed and modified through the BIOS setup utility.
8 USB Headers: USB headers on the motherboard allow for additional USB ports to be added to the system using front panel connectors These headers are used for connecting devices such as keyboards, mice, printers, and external storage devices The number and type of USB headers vary depending on the motherboard model.
9 Audio Connectors: Audio connectors on the motherboard allow for audio devices, such as speakers and microphones, to be connected to the system These connectors provide audio input and output capabilities, allowing users to hear sound from the system and communicate through voice chat or video conferencing.
